When deciding on a location for their summer wedding, which was held on August 30, 2025, the couple turned to the Loire Valley in France, a place filled with meaning for both of their families. Not only was Alexandre’s father French, but the bride’s aunt and uncle, Thierry and Clare Vivier, own a home in the region. The to-be-weds decided on Château de la Huberdière—a retreat in Nazelles-Négron that overlooked Leonardo da Vinci’s final resting place—as their venue. “The chateau’s owners, Patrick and Lodo, are expats from Italy and well-versed in helping others celebrate this special region,” explains Sophia.
The bride was well-versed in organizing events herself after a decade of working in fashion at brands like Ulla Johnson, so she took charge of organizing the wedding celebration. “I felt confident we did not need to hire a wedding planner and could handle it ourselves, even while living thousands of miles away in LA,” Sophia says. “We were engaged for a year and a half—which helped—and I truly enjoyed researching vendors, gathering inspiration, and ensuring each creative detail had meaning and intention.” The couple also hired Maryne Olive Marchesi of Marchesi Weddings as a month-of coordinator to ensure all the final details were settled and relieve the bride of planning duties that final week. “If not for her (and Alex!) stepping up, their support allowed me to be present and enjoy every single moment,” adds Sophia. “I would be remiss not to mention Clare’s husband, Thierry, whose family is from the area and served as our ‘boots on the ground’—and incredible translator—throughout the planning process.”
The celebrations would move from casual to elegant, beginning with an outdoor party on Thursday evening at Clare Vivier’s garden in Saint-Calais. “Everything was prepared by family members, who were in and out of the kitchen all afternoon, and then we brought in a local crêpe truck for dinner,” describes the bride. “The party went late into the night, with an impromptu concert with my uncles playing guitar, my cousins taking turns on the mic, and Alexandre DJ-ing and guests dancing to Prince and Sade under the stars.”
